Sessia House (formerly known as The Church of Ireland House) on Donegall Street is a four-storey office building that served as the administrative headquarters for the Church of Ireland in Belfast for nearly 30 years.
Originally constructed in the 1980s and extensively refurbished in the 1990s, the property includes ground floor retail units with frontage to Donegall Street and Talbot Street, as well as a car park at the rear accessible from Talbot Street.
In February 2025, Neighbourhood Café relocated to a ground floor retail unit in Sessia House.
